Faxes – Sending, Status, Content, and Options


Select on the left panel to access the fax screen. The screen is divided into two areas – one showing existing faxes (sent or received) and their statuses and one for viewing fax content and related options or to send a new fax.


If you are not able to see or receive faxes check the eFax Channels MANAGE FAX ACCOUNTS option in the TeleConsole's settings and ensure that at least one of your fax channels is active!


Sending a New Fax


Send a new fax by clicking  .


Entering Contacts and Selecting Caller ID


Enter a contact's name or number in the To: field at the top. A fax can be sent to one or multiple contacts. Matching results, for both company and personal contacts, will be suggested. Select the desired one(s). Make sure to select a number that can accept faxes!

If a contact has more than one phone number all will be available for selection. Again, make sure to select the fax-specific number.



The name or number of recipients that you faxed recently appears under the RECENTLY SENT listClick the name or number to add it to the To: field. Click    to add the number as a new contact to your list of contacts (if the contact already exists, clicking the button will open his details instead.) To remove an item from the RECENTLY SENT list, hover your mouse over it and select 


Note that the RECENTLY SENT contacts list is specific to the fax screen. The keypad and messages screens have their own separate "Recent Contacts" list! Also, the list is only available locally on the device and is not available on other devices you use with your account.

You can select a different caller ID for your fax line by clicking the From: drop-down menu. The default number appearing here is selected in the Default Fax Number settings.

Cover Page


To select or remove the cover page of the fax click the Cover page: drop-down menu. Presently you can only select No cover or Default fax cover page. But if you need a costume cover page you can email us with the design and logo and we will add it to your account.

After selecting a cover page enter the relevant information in the First and last name, Company / Department, and Cover page note.

You can click    to see the design of the selected cover page. The default Telebroad design looks like this

Attaching Files


Drag and drop the file(s) you want to fax from another window to the Attach file box or click the box to open a navigation window and select the relevant file. You can fax text files, PDFs, or picture files. You can attach other kinds of files (even sound files), but sending them will result in a "Fax sent failed" error.

You can select multiple files up to a 20MB total limit (an individual file size should also not exceed this limit.) If you want to remove a selected file click    on its thumbnail.

Click SEND to fax the file(s) or CANCEL to exit.


Fax Status


A fax status is indicated in the existing faxes area together with the number of pages sent or received. 


There are three possible statuses for sent faxes. When sending a fax, its status will initially show as "Fax sending" while it is being processed. Once the fax has been sent it will either show as "Fax sent successful" or "Fax sent failed".  


Usually, a fax fails to send because it was not sent to a number that cannot accept faxes. On rare occasions, it is also possible the Telebroad fax server is down. You can see the status of the server here

You can try to resend a failed fax from the fax options (see below.)


Received faxes have only one status and are shown as – "Fax received".


For sent faxes you will also get an email with the status of the fax and some additional details.



Fax Content and Filtering


From the list of existing faxes, select any fax to show its content. 


Faxes you received are shown as black and white images while faxes you sent are shown in color. For received faxes, you will see the sender's and recipient's (your) phone numbers at the top of the fax document.  


Click    to filter the type of faxes shown – All Faxes, Sent Faxes, Received Faxes, or Failed Faxes. If you can't find a specific fax make sure it is not being filtered out by your selection here. You can always select All Faxes or use the global search feature to find it.

Failed faxes are faxes that failed to deliver due to the recipient's phone number not being able to receive faxes, his fax line is not physically connected, or his line not available. You can resend a failed fax from the fax options (see next.)

On some rare occasions, a fax will fail to send because of a problem with the Telebroad server. You can check the status of the server here.



Fax Options


When you select a fax, the following options are available for it on the top-right corner of the screen:

  • Select    to place a call to the other party who sent you the fax or received it from you. The dial pad screen will open with the other party's number automatically inserted in the call recipient's field.

  • Select    to print the fax using the system's standard printing prompt.

  • Select    for contact options 

    • If the person who faxed you already exists in your contacts, this will open his details in the contacts screen.

    • If the person does not exist in your contacts, you will get the option to Create new contact with his number or Add (his number) to existing contact. See more about creating new contacts here.

  • Select   for additional menu options –

    • Select    to resend the fax. This option only shows for failed faxes.

      When selected, the fax will not be resent instantly. Instead, the fax sending screen will show all of the existing contact details and attachments to let you make changes (like fixing the phone number) first.

    • Select    to forward the fax – fax it to another contact. The fax sending screen will open with the forwarded fax already attached to it as a PDF file. You just need to enter the contact information and you can attach additional files.

    • Select    to download a copy of the fax as a PDF to your local or network drive.

      By default, the file will be saved in your Downloads folder, but you will be prompted to select the download location and you can also change the file name before saving it.
       
    • Select    to delete the fax transmission and select DELETE when prompted to approve the deletion.
